Workers’ Compensation


The North Carolina General Assembly created the Industrial Commission in 1929 to administer the state’s first Workers’ Compensation Act. Tailored to address the complex issues arising from workplace injuries and occupational diseases, the Act provides compensation to injured workers pursuant to the criteria set forth in Chapter 97 of the North Carolina General Statutes.
